What is OpenSource?
Open Source Initiative (OSI) is a non-profit corporation
dedicated to managing and promoting the Open Source Definition
for the good of the community, specifically through the OSI
Certified Open Source Software certification mark and program .
You can read about successful software products that have these
properties, and about our certification mark and program, which
allow you to be confident that software really is "Open Source."
We also make copies of approved open source licenses here.
The basic idea behind open source is very simple: When
programmers can read, redistribute, and modify the source code
for a piece of software, the software evolves. People improve
it, people adapt it, people fix bugs.

What are Contribution?
Since OpenSource code is accessible to anyone, there are lots of
programmers who volunteer to create lots of add-on modules which
are otherwise called as "Contribution". Generally these
contribution carries good installation instructions.
